Job Description:

The overall purpose of the Group Risk & Compliance (“GRC”) function is to protect the Group brand and to support the successful execution of the Group’s business strategy through the delivery of an integrated risk and compliance culture and programme across the Group. GRC’s mandate extends to all Business and Operational Support Units across the IQ-EQ Group, including all domestic and international subsidiaries, joint ventures and associated entities.

What you'll do 

  • You'll lead and challenge the periodic Key Risk Indicator (KRI) reporting process, ensuring timely data uploads to MetricStream, clear articulation of issues, and SMART action tracking and escalation across Clusters.
  • You'll produce and enhance structured Risk Reports and dashboards, delivering high-quality insights to senior management and Governance Committees, while continuously improving the scope and timeliness of GRC reporting.
  • You'll collaborate closely with Risk & Compliance teams across the Group, supporting the Head of GRC Strategy & Operations and Governance & Operations Director to advance the GRC agenda and foster a strong risk culture.
  • You'll drive the implementation and evolution of GRC systems and processes, including maintaining and developing Power BI dashboards, and ensuring reporting deadlines are met across business areas.
  • You'll demonstrate strong analytical and communication skills, a constructive mindset, resilience in a fast-paced environment, and the ability to build trusted relationships and high-performing teams with cultural sensitivity and emotional intelligence.
